On Mon, Sep 25, 2006 at 12:35:34AM +0200, Sam Ravnborg wrote:
> On what architectures do you see lots of these warnings - maybe fixable?
> Otherwise I could do something like this:
Try allmodconfig someday...
aviro@icy:/usr/src/cross-kernel/volatile/work$ grep -l WARNING.*undefined ../logs/*/X4c
../logs/alpha-SMP/X4c
../logs/alpha/X4c
../logs/arm/X4c
../logs/armv/X4c
../logs/chestnut/X4c
../logs/frv/X4c
../logs/ia64/X4c
../logs/m32r/X4c
../logs/m68k/X4c
../logs/ppc/X4c
../logs/ppc44x/X4c
../logs/ppc64/X4c
../logs/s390/X4c
../logs/s390x/X4c
../logs/sparc32/X4c
../logs/sparc64/X4c
../logs/sun3/X4c
../logs/sun4/X4c
../logs/uml-i386/X4c
That's out of 25 targets. The only variants that do _NOT_ trigger are
amd64, amd64-UP, i386 and uml-amd64.
I more or less agree with rationale behind making that default, but I'd
very much appreciate a way to override that. For now I've just made the
-w line unconditional, but the fewer infrastructure patches I've to carry...
